This morning I received a letter from up above, assign me to go to air port tomorrow before 9.30am. I am part of thousand people who are assigned to greet the GREAT LEADER OF BURMA. This is against my wills, I am a person who believe in human rights, democracy, and freedom. To me Burmese leaders is not in the position where people should give respect, but they are just a gang of criminals, who will do every thing to hold on to power. Help me: Should I join them or not?
